Loose table. Villian 1(700) is LAG. Villian 2(710) is TAG. Hero(660) has a TAG image, and is button7 players, blinds 5-10Hand: Ac QdAction:UTG raises to 35, Villian 1 calls, Villian 2 calls, MP 1 calls, Hero calls, SB calls, BB calls.(This is the first family pot of the night).Pot:245 Flop Ad 2d 3hAction: Everyone checks to hero, hero bets 200, Villian 1 calls, Villian 2 calls.Pot:845Turn: Ad 2d 3h (9d)Action: Villian 1 checks, Villian 2 bets 150, Hero calls, Villian 1 foldsPot: 1145River: Ad 2d 3h (9d) (As)Action: Villian 2 bets 200 (leaving himself with 185), Hero....?????I think it is pretty damn obvious I'm up against either a flush or a full house (22, 33, 99 would all fit given how he played it, as would a couple of high diamonds like JdKd) The problem was the pot odds, as the pot was about 1300. What would you have differently, and what would you do on the end?

I just don't like it with a decent sized raise and a few calls in front of me, because it's too easy to get in to a tough situation, just as we did here. Things that call raises preflop (small pairs, suited connectors, etc) could have hit this flop pretty hard. We have top pair, second kicker. If we get any pressure here, we're going to have no choice but to lay the hand down.Seems like you need an almost perfect flop to continue the hand. When it gets checked to us on the flop, I like betting out, but the hope is to take the pot down right there.The way this was played, and due to the size of the pot, we have to call the river when the 3rd ace hits, but I think we're behind here often.

Hands that play well multi-way, like middle suited connectors, and medium pairs (no set-no bet). They're easy to get away from if they miss the flop, but will likely get the proper odds to call if you flop a strong draw. If the AQ were suited, that changes it to a call, imo, but you're not really calling with it just to hit the ace. Just to clarify, is this from a tourney or a cash game?
